
(Patria) - Federal Minister of Internal Affairs Ramo Isak commented on the announcements that several police officers from the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Republic of Serbia will seasonally perform official duties on the territory of Bosnia and Herzegovina, i.e., that they will assist police officers of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of RS.
“I call on politicians and public officials not to unnecessarily raise tensions and not to create a sense of fear among the citizens of Bosnia and Herzegovina. Through irresponsible behavior, politicking, and the tendency to gain cheap political points at all costs in an election year, fear is unnecessarily instilled among citizens.
All politicians, with a very simple internet search, can find data on inter-police cooperation between the ministries of internal affairs of the region. As an example, I will mention that police officers from the Ministry of Internal Affairs of Canton Sarajevo have been on the territory of the Republic of Croatia on several occasions, where they provided assistance to police officers of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Republic of Croatia in performing official duties and tasks during the tourist season.
Also, as an example of inter-police cooperation, I will mention the fact that the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Republic of Serbia has police officers deployed in the Republic of Croatia and Montenegro during the tourist season, and that the Ministry of Internal Affairs of RS will deploy its police officers to the territory of the Republic of Serbia during the tourist season.
Inter-police cooperation during tourist seasons, as well as in all other forms of inter-police cooperation, is carried out in accordance with national legislation and signed agreements,” Isak stated.
He said that it is irresponsible and shameful to present inter-police cooperation as an attempt at aggression and to create an image that six police officers from the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Republic of Serbia, who will be deployed as assistance during the tourist season in Banja Luka, Foča, and Trebinje, represent a national threat to Bosnia and Herzegovina.
"Once again, I call on politicians not to raise tensions and not to scare the citizens of Bosnia and Herzegovina. The security system is not a field on which you should conduct election campaigns.
I responsibly assure the citizens of Bosnia and Herzegovina that they have no reason to fear and that there will be no disruption of security in Bosnia and Herzegovina, especially not aggression,” Isak stated.
